An atomic nucleus at rest at the origin of an xy coordinate system transforms into three particles. Particle l, mass 16.7 x 10-27 kg, moves away from the origin at velocity (6.00 x 106 m/s)i; particle 2, mass 8.35 x 10–27 kg, moves away at velocity (–8.00 x 106 m/s)i.
(a) In unit-vector notation, what is the linear momentum of the third particle, mass 11.7 x 10–27 kg?
(b) How much kinetic energy appears in this transformation?
